Many prominent figures from the world of football and thousands of fans have said goodbye to Christoph Daum. In the 1. FC Köln stadium, his former clubs 1. FC Köln, VfB Stuttgart and Bayer Leverkusen held the memorial service for the long-time coach, who died on August 24th at the age of 70 from the effects of a serious cancer illness. “His uniqueness opened hearts and doors. He was one of the most dazzling personalities in German football. We will not forget him,” said DFB President Bernd Neuendorf.
In addition to the DFB president, delegations from various clubs also came, as well as Daum’s friend, Federal Minister of Agriculture Cem Özdemir, Reiner Calmund, Rudi Völler, VfB board member Alexander Wehrle, ex-manager Michael Meier and many of Daum’s former protégés. These included the ex-world champions Thomas Häßler and Pierre Littbarski.
